Since 1962 World Theatre Day has been celebrated by theatre professionals and theatre lovers all over the world on 27th of March. This day is a celebration for those who value the importance of theatre. Each year an outstanding theatre figure is invited to share his or her reflections on theatre. This – known as the International Message – is translated into more than 50 languages and read for spectators before performances in theatres throughout the world.
